A bounty world is basically PVP (player versus player) only you receive a certain amount of bounty, loot, valuable items, etc. for killing another player. The amount of bounty you get and the amount that it is worth depends. By standing in a PVP hotspot your EP will go up. The higher up your EP goes, the more your bounty will cost. Also, in bounty worlds, fighting takes place in The Wilderness, and if you die, you re-spawn in Edgeville. Players under level 20 are not allowed in Bounty or PVP worlds.Hope that answers your question.

Bounty bars originate from the United Kingdom and were first introduced by the Mars Company in 1951. They are made with a coconut filling coated in milk chocolate or dark chocolate. The bars are named after the HMS Bounty, a ship famous for its voyage to the South Seas, which inspired the tropical coconut flavor. Today, Bounty bars are produced in various locations around the world.
